Section 2: The Rise of AI in Marketing


Artificial Intelligence has revolutionised many aspects of digital marketing. Its ability to analyse vast amounts of data and automate complex processes has made it an invaluable tool for businesses of all sizes. One of the most visible applications of AI in marketing is through chatbots. These AI-powered virtual assistants provide instant customer support, guiding users through their queries and purchase processes. By automating responses, businesses can offer 24/7 support, significantly enhancing customer satisfaction and loyalty.


Another critical application of AI is in personalised recommendations. By analysing user behaviour, preferences, and purchase history, AI algorithms can suggest products or services tailored to individual needs. This personalisation not only improves the shopping experience but also increases the likelihood of conversions. For instance, e-commerce giants like Amazon and Netflix use AI to recommend products and content, respectively, contributing significantly to their success.


Predictive analytics is another powerful AI tool in marketing. By analysing historical data, AI can forecast future trends, customer behaviours, and potential market shifts. This foresight enables businesses to make informed decisions, optimise their marketing campaigns, and allocate resources more effectively. The benefits of AI in marketing are clear: increased efficiency, improved personalisation, and a better understanding of customer needs.


Section 3: Data-Driven Marketing: Unlocking Insights


Data has become the lifeblood of modern marketing. The ability to collect, analyse, and interpret data is crucial for understanding customers and creating effective marketing strategies. Data-driven marketing involves using data insights to guide decision-making processes, from product development to customer engagement strategies.


There are various types of data that businesses can leverage. Behavioural data, which tracks user interactions and activities, helps understand customer journeys and pain points. Demographic data provides information on customer age, gender, income level, and more, allowing for targeted marketing efforts. Transactional data, detailing past purchases and interactions, helps predict future behaviours and personalize offerings.


Businesses that successfully use data-driven strategies can create highly targeted campaigns that resonate with specific audiences. For example, Coca-Cola's "Share a Coke" campaign used customer names on bottles, leveraging data on popular names to create a personalised experience. This campaign not only boosted sales but also enhanced brand engagement.


Section 4: SEO in the Era of AI and Data


Search engine optimisation (SEO) remains a cornerstone of digital marketing, even as AI and data become more prevalent. SEO practices have evolved, with search engines like Google using AI algorithms to rank content. Understanding these changes is essential for maintaining and improving search rankings.


One major shift in SEO is the focus on content quality and relevance. With AI's ability to analyse and understand natural language, search engines are better at determining the context and value of content. Therefore, creating high-quality, informative, and engaging content is more critical than ever. Additionally, user experience (UX) has become a significant ranking factor. This includes website speed, mobile-friendliness, and intuitive navigation, all of which contribute to better search visibility.


Data plays a pivotal role in SEO strategies. Keyword research, once reliant on intuition and guesswork, is now a data-driven process. Marketers can use tools like Google Analytics and SEMrush to identify high-performing keywords, understand user intent, and optimise content accordingly. Performance tracking and A/B testing further allow for continuous improvement of SEO strategies.


Section 5: Integrating AI, Data, and SEO: A Holistic Approach


The integration of AI, data-driven strategies, and SEO creates a comprehensive and effective marketing approach. This synergy allows businesses to be more agile, responsive, and customer-centric. For example, AI can automate data analysis and provide real-time insights, which can then inform SEO strategies and content creation.


To implement this integrated approach, businesses can leverage various tools and technologies. AI-powered platforms like HubSpot and Marketo offer marketing automation, customer relationship management (CRM), and analytics features. SEO tools such as Ahrefs and Moz provide insights into keyword performance and competitor analysis. By combining these resources, businesses can streamline their marketing efforts and achieve better results.


However, integrating these elements is not without challenges. Businesses may face issues related to data privacy, technological infrastructure, and the need for specialised skills. It's essential to address these challenges by investing in the right technology, training staff, and maintaining transparent data practices.
